  • Blenheim Palace: Located a mere 559m from Bladon, this UNESCO World Heritage Site is the birthplace of Winston Churchill. Explore its magnificent baroque architecture, stunning gardens, and rich history, making it a perfect spot for culture enthusiasts.
  • University of Oxford: Situated 4.3km away, this esteemed institution boasts centuries of academic excellence. Wander through its historic colleges, admire the breathtaking architecture, and soak in the vibrant atmosphere of one of the world’s oldest universities.
  • Oxford Castle: Also 4.3km from Bladon, this medieval castle offers a blend of history and romance. Discover its intriguing past, enjoy guided tours, and take in the panoramic views from the tower.

Best time to go to Bladon

The best time to visit Bladon is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January38.8°F (3.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February40.1°F (4.5°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March43.0°F (6.1°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
April46.9°F (8.3°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
May52.5°F (11.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June58.3°F (14.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July62.2°F (16.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
August61.7°F (16.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
September57.7°F (14.3°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
October52.2°F (11.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
November45.1°F (7.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
December41.2°F (5.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
